Meaning of one swell foop | Babel Free

Noun CEFR C1

Definitions

Spoonerism of one fell swoop.

Examples

“Only one meal a week is required, thus doing away, at one swell foop, with cooks, scullions, stewards, butlers, waiters and other tip-extractors.”
“You have to pull it in, in one swell foop!.”
“If I can’t quite see how to do it all in one swell foop, I fall back on the principles of lazy programming: [...]”
